Pco License - The Steps And Requirements

A driver can find himself in various types of circumstances where he might have to drive for a variety of celebrities and well-known people. Consequently, this work might seem to be exciting enough but conversely, there might be huge liability on the driver to get the traveler to where they need to go on time whatever be the conditions. So it is not simple to become a skilled chauffeur.
By seeing the procedure one can figure out, it is not like anybody can just acquire a vehicle and begin a chauffeur service. They have to go through various phases before they are provided with a PCO permit or PCO license. Apart from these credentials, the chauffeur also requires to be sure and has to have very good driving and social skills so that the traveler feels relaxed.
Talking about different phases, the first step that one will have to undergo to get a Pco Licence is personal Information Checks. There are little requirements for this, like for the starters’ one will have to be over twenty one years of age but there is no higher limit on age providing one meets the other requirements. One will also have to undergo a criminal ...
... record check before being certified. Further information that will be checked at is the driving license which one needs to have for as a minimum of 3 years.
Apart from that, one will have to undergo a physical test called Group 2 Standards for obtaining the license. The benchmark is similar to those utilized for chauffeurs of large heavy goods automobiles, buses and coaches. One will have to confirm their medical fitness by undertaking a medical test.
The third requirement is route Planning as one must be able to interpret a map and be able to choose a suitable route. One may also have to exceed a topographical exam at a centre to show your skills. The things topographical test might include are route selection, map reading, intermediate route selection, long distance route selection and general topography.
